Originally published on August 2, 2013<br /><br />A NATO helicopter mistakenly fired on and killed five Afghan police on July 31 after the men called in air support when they came under insurgent attack. <br /><br />Afghan police were stationed at a highway checkpoint in the Nangarhar province, 120 km from the capital, Kabul. The men came under insurgent attack and called for air support from coalition NATO forces.<br /><br />The exact circumstances of what happened are not clear, but a US-flown helicopter arrived at the scene.<br /><br />For some reason it's crew mistakenly engaged the Afghan national forces, inadvertently killing five men and injuring two.<br /><br />Unintended Afghan deaths caused by Western air strikes are a serious source of friction between the Afghan government and its Western allies.
